#!/bin/sh
# This script will check if any APT upgrade is available and
# will prepare the host in order to apply upgrade with another script
# 1. Create a temp file
# 2. Disable SGE queue
# This script can be call by a cronjob (eg. weekly)
# Another script should try to apply upgrades also with cron (eg. hourly)

is_sge_master_available() { # {{{
## Check with Netcat if SGE master (sge_qmaster) is reachable from this host.
### -z: Only scan for listening daemons, without sending any data to them.
### -w 10: Timeout the test after 10 seconds.
if nc -z -w 10 "${sge_master_uri}" "${sge_master_port}"; then
return_is_sge_master_available="0"
debug_message "is_sge_master_available \
SGE Master (${sge_master_uri}:${sge_master_port}) is reachable from this host."
else
return_is_sge_master_available="1"
debug_message "is_sge_master_available \
SGE Master (${sge_master_uri}:${sge_master_port}) is not reachable from this host."
fi
return "${return_is_sge_master_available}"
}

is_apt_upgrade_absent() { # {{{
## Count the number of upgradable packages and substract 1 for the header
